Pack a large bucket or basket with crumpled packing paper. Cover two wide strips of cardboard with decorative tissue. Wedge the
cardboard strips between the bucket and the crumpled paper pushing them to the bottom of the bucket. The cardboard strips should
be wide enough to cover the back half of the bucket and should be approximately 6 to 7 inches taller than the container. Next pick
a large lightweight inflatable object. For example, if you are designing a pamper gift basket than you could inflate a bath pillow and secure
it to one of the cardboard strips using double sided tape and more crumpled packing paper.
Balance the opposite side of the basket with a product that is light weight and equally as high. If you can't find a product that would
fit in with the theme, you can always cut a piece of cardboard to the right size and then cover it with tissue paper then use a plant stake
to secure it in the packing paper.
Use full sheets of tissue paper the fill in around the edges of the basket. Then start placing your products in the front section of the
basket starting with the largest and working your way down to the smallest products. You can create pockets in the packing paper and use
more of the full tissue sheets to help secure the products as you're placing them.
